Japanese Car Scorecard -June 2003

TOKYO, July 28, 2003; Reuters reported that Japan's largest automaker, Toyota Motor Corp, said on Monday its global output rose 14.5 percent in June from a year earlier to 528,137 vehicles. Output at second-biggest Honda Motor Co grew 0.2 percent to 244,119 units, while third-ranked Nissan Motor Co produced 248,429 vehicles worldwide, up 11.3 percent. The following are figures for domestic output, domestic sales, exports and overseas output of vehicles at Japan's five leading carmakers for June, with percentage changes from the year before. JUNE 2003 Japan Output Japan Sales Exports Toyota 300,998 (+ 6.7) 149,792 (+ 6.4) 147,980 (+ 0.4) Nissan 122,340 (+13.0) 66,318 (- 3.4) 60,189 (+11.3) Honda 98,956 (-15.8) 58,215 (-34.6) 41,459 (+ 1.0) M'bishi 57,797 (+ 1.8) 34,257 (+22.2) 27,498 (-20.2) Mazda 64,407 (+ 1.8) 22,811 (+11.4) 44,235 (+ 8.6) Overseas Output Global Output Toyota 227,139 (+26.8) 528,137 (+14.5) Nissan 126,089 (+ 9.7) 248,429 (+11.3) Honda 145,163 (+15.1) 244,119 (+ 0.2) M'bishi 76,526 (- 7.0) 134,323 (- 3.4) Mazda 19,077 (+53.0) 83,484 (+10.3)
